Rusch has a spoiler-free post about how the TV show Stranger Things skyrocketed a thirty-plus-year-old song by Kate Bush up the sales charts.

But more importantly, it's about how Bush fought to retain the copyright to that song, "Running Up That Hill" (and to her other work) — and how much it's literally paying off right now.
